LLNL Emergency Plan <br />Rev-23 <br />October 2017 <br /> <br /> 69 <br />If a release or potential release of radiological or non-radiological hazardous material poses a <br />threat to workers and/or the public, the EMDO may categorize the event as an Operational <br />Emergency and then classify the event as an Alert, Site Area Emergency, or General Emergency, <br />depending on the EAL. The appropriate categorization/classification level will be declared <br />following event identification using the applicable EALs. For security-related incidents, the PFD <br />Security IC gathers information about the incident and contacts the SDO, who consults with the <br />EMDO to determine whether or not the incident is an Operational Emergency based on the <br />applicable EALs. <br />Under Unified Command, declaration of an Operational Emergency may be warranted based on <br />law enforcement or security concerns not involving or potentially involving hazardous materials. <br />In this case, the EMDO declares the Operational Emergency and determines the categorization <br />and classification based on a description of the situation provided by the SDO. Classification of a <br />Security Operational Emergency as an Alert, Site Area Emergency, or General Emergency is <br />based on the potential for a release of hazardous materials and the projected consequences. The <br />PFD procedures describe notification of Security Organization management and the Battalion <br />Chief. These notification guidelines are provided for in the PFD’s Tactical Defense Plan. <br />Depending upon the event, the SDO, in consultation with the Security Organization Director or <br />designee and NNSA/LFO, may recommend implementation of a Security Condition (SECON) <br />level commensurate with the threat posed to LLNL by the event. Actions and criteria for <br />implementing a security condition level are described in the LLNL Security Conditions <br />Implementation Plan. <br />As described in Section 2.4 of this Emergency Plan, the EMDO activates the ERO based on <br />event categorization/classification and in accordance with Emergency Programs Organization <br />plans/procedures (see Table 2.3). Activation of all facilities is automatic for General <br />Emergencies. Activation of all facilities, except the JIC (LEDO discretion in consultation with <br />the PAO Manager), is automatic for Site Area Emergencies. For other emergency events, <br />including Operational Emergencies at the Alert level, activation is based on LEDO guidance.
